The Fornax Cluster represents an important step in the extragalactic distance scale. Here we present a new I-band luminosity-H I velocity width (I-band Tully-Fisher) study of the cluster using an enlarged sampled of spiral galaxies in Fornax. I-band CCD photometry and 21 cm parameters are measured for 23 members of Fornax and compared with data for the Virgo Cluster. We obtain an accurate distance modulus of Fornax relative to Virgo of -0.06 +/- 0.15 mag. The low scatter of Fornax galaxies around the Tully-Fisher relation will make the cluster an ideal calibrator once a direct measurement of its distance is obtained. Furthermore, the H I content of the galaxies does not seem affected by the cluster environment. Here we use two different absolute calibration methods which yield an absolute distance to Fornax of 15.4 +/- 2.3 Mpc (absolute distance modulus of 30.94 +/- 0.33 mag). A simple model yields a Local Group Virgocentric flow velocity of 224 +/- 90 km s(-1) which corresponds to a Hubble constant of H-o = 74 +/- 11 km s(-1) Mpc(-1) from the Fornax data.
